Java,編碼和應用訪談的動態編程課程

動態Java編程,編碼訪談和應用程序

成為熟練的開發人員,主導有效的動態編程算法

您是否想知道偉大的開發人員有什麼區別?為什麼大型技術公司現在要求候選人在訪談中解決複雜的編碼難題?為什麼您要擔心學習複雜的算法?在技​​術技能方面,熟練的開發人員對計算機科學有著深入的了解,並且知道如何有效地應用這些知識。技術公司認識到,如果有人掌握了這些基本原理,他們可能會成功學習任何編程語言,適應新工具並解決廣泛的編程問題。了解數據結構和算法,開發人員已經準備好在日常工作和編碼訪談中面臨具有挑戰性的問題。動態編程是數據結構和算法中的至關重要主題。它涵蓋了算法範式來解決特定類別的問題。在本課程中,我們詳細探討了這個主題,探索了幾個示例。該課程的目的是實用,較少關注數學和形式定義。相反,您將通過日常編程算法和編碼訪談難題學習。我們提供了一種方法來確定可以使用動態編程解決的問題,並通過增量步驟指導您構建有效的解決方案。另外,您還將了解專業賭博,空中交通管制並成為認真的作家。可以在用戶名/項目下的GitHub找到:FictiuryName/DynamicProminmingInva。在課程結束時,包括一個小型的編碼練習來評估您的知識。

您將從本課程中獲得什麼:

  • 能夠使用動態編程來識別可以解決的問題
  • 熟練使用Java從頂部和自下而上的動態編程解決方案開發
  • 動態編程在編碼訪談和現實情況中的實際應用
  • 提高解決問題的技能,成為更熟練的開發人員
  • 對遞歸知識的完整審查
Scroll to Top